Course Content

• Microfinance Institutions: Structure, Operations, and Regulation
• Poverty Alleviation and Microfinance: Impact Measurement and Evaluation
• Microfinance Policy and the Regulatory Framework (including legal frameworks and compliance)
• Financial Inclusion and Access to Credit: Reaching the Underserved
• Microfinance and Economic Development: Growth, Stability and Sustainability
• Gender and Microfinance: Empowering Women Through Finance
• Risk Management in Microfinance: Credit Scoring and Portfolio Management
• Microfinance and Technology: Digital Finance and Fintech solutions
• Ethical Considerations in Microfinance: Social Performance Management and Client Protection
• Microfinance Policy in a Global Context: Comparative Analysis and Best Practices

Career path

Career Role Description
Microfinance Officer Provides financial services to underserved communities, assessing creditworthiness and managing loan portfolios. High demand for strong analytical and interpersonal skills.
Microfinance Consultant (Policy) Advises organizations and governments on microfinance policy, strategy, and regulation. Requires extensive knowledge of microfinance principles and policy frameworks.
Impact Assessment Specialist (Microfinance) Evaluates the social and economic impact of microfinance initiatives using quantitative and qualitative data analysis techniques. Excellent data analysis skills are essential.
Financial Inclusion Manager Develops and implements strategies to increase access to financial services for marginalized populations. Strong project management skills are needed.
